Lets evaluate the scripture I posted.
John 16:8-11 NCV (Holy Bible)
8 When the Helper comes, he will prove to the people of the world the truth about sin, about being right with God, and about judgment.9 He will prove to them that sin is not believing in me.10 He will prove to them that being right with God comes from my going to the Father and not being seen anymore. 11 And the Helper will prove to them that judgment happened when the ruler of this world was judged.
Verse 8 says the helper (the spirit of God) will show the world (us) 3 things. What sin is, how to be right with God and how we shall be judged.
What is sin? ---- "sin is not believing in me." Jesus is a few hours from crucifixion when he reveals this. He is through with the parables and he is through with the hidden meanings. He is out of time. So he is saying it as plainly as he can. I can't elaborate on this because this is as blunt as it gets.
So how can I be right with God (i.e. Righteousness)? -- "being right with God comes from my going to the Father and not being seen anymore." You wanna please God? Be 'right' with him? Have faith! What is faith? Believing the impossible. People today mock Jesus. They mock faith. They mock church. They mock your beliefs. Romans 3:4 says, "...the Scripture says, 'Abraham believed God, and God accepted Abraham's faith, and that faith made him right with God.' Thats all God is looking for. Thats all he has ever wanted. Believe just one thing. Jesus existed. He died so I could live, then went to be with His father in Heaven. Believe in that and God will be pleased with you beyond anything you could believe.
How will we be judged? -- "judgment happened when the ruler of this world was judged." It is finished. You will not be judged for any wrong you do because Jesus was already tried, proved guilty, convicted and handed the death penalty for all your wrongs. You are free because He took the rap for you.
